cpsIfInvalidSrcRateLimitValue

cps If Invalid Src Rate Limit Value
1.3.6.1.4.1.9.9.315.1.2.1.1.17

'true' then this value is used to limit the rate at which packets with invalid source MAC addresses are processed on this interface. Upon exceeding the rate, the port is shutdown. If cpsIfInvalidSrcRateLimitEnable is set to 'false' then this value will be -1.
